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5003 58622006 57609565 414100093
787177134 483
787177134 483
8050 100251148 730067
All about undefined
Interested in learning more?
787177134 483
8050 100251148 730067
See more
797204695 30151644
5601 781626227 608
See more
37225 48201718 1820
63990451616 77 803060
See more